These obscure 22x26 regional Ohio restaurant chain giveaways took a walk on the wild side of design for baseball collectibles. Photos of Indians players are tinted in pastel shades of blue, pink or yellow and are bordered with psychedelic flair around the perimeter, with the Girves logo located at bottom center. Positive dating is derived by the group of featured players, who only teamed together for Cleveland in 1972. These players are: Gaylord Perry (VG), Graig Nettles (EX), Chris Chambliss (VG-EX), Ray Fosse (VG) and Alex Johnson (VG-EX). While we're this far over the rainbow, we'll put forth the notion that these oddball posters are extremely rare survivors, as there is no evidence of any other existing examples to be found.
